UNITED STATES COMMITTEE ON IRRIGATION AND DRAINAGE, founded in 1988, is a micro nonprofit that reported $34K in total revenue in fiscal year 2021. Revenue surged 38%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$18K, a strong 52% operating margin.

Mission

PURPOSE IS TO PROMOTE THE DEVELOPMENT AND APPLICATION OF THE SCIENCES AND TECHNIQUES OF IRRIGATION, DRAINAGE, FLOOD CONTROL AND RIVER STABILIZATION. MEMBERS PARTICIPATE TO FOSTER SUSTAINABLE, SOCIALLY ACCEPTABLE AND ENVIRONMENTALLY RESPONSIBLE IRRIGATION, DRAINAGE AND FLOOD CONTROL SYSTEMS FOR PROVIDING FOOD, CLOTHING, AND SHELTER TO THE PEOPLE OF THE UNITED STATES AND THE WORLD.
